  1. 26. Predicting Sheared Edge Characteristics of High Strength Steels

    Författare :Olle Sandin; Daniel Casellas; Pär Jonsén; Jörgen Kajberg; Rickard Östlund; Luleå tekniska universitet; []
    Nyckelord :TEKNIK OCH TEKNOLOGIER; ENGINEERING AND TECHNOLOGY; Hållfasthetslära; Solid Mechanics;

    Sammanfattning : An efficient way of reducing CO2 emissions from the transportation sector is to reduce the vehicle weights, i.e. lightweighting. A common strategy for lightweighting of vehicles is to replace the steels used to build structural parts of the vehicle, usually manufactured by metallic sheets, with stronger, advanced high strength steel (AHSS) grades.   2. 27. Modelling of fracture toughness using peridynamics : A Study of J-integral, essential work and homogenisation

    Författare :Christer Stenström; Pär Jonsén; Kjell Eriksson; Ugo Galvanetto; Luleå tekniska universitet; []
    Nyckelord :TEKNIK OCH TEKNOLOGIER; ENGINEERING AND TECHNOLOGY; Peridynamics; J-integral; Essential work of fracture; Nonlocal methods; Meshless; Meshfree; Fracture; Crack tip; Exact analytical; Center cracked tension; Double edge notched tensile; fracture toughness; Peridynamik; Brottmekanik; Sprickspets; Brottseghet; Spänningsintensitet; Hållfasthetslära; Solid Mechanics;

    Sammanfattning : Fracture toughness is one of the most important properties of a material. Being able toaccurately estimate the energy that goes into forming new crack surfaces is essential for the development of new materials, quality assurance, structural monitoring and failure analysis.   3. 28. Mechanical Characterization of Heterogeneous Brittle Materials

    Författare :Laura Suarez; Pär Jonsén; Jörgen Kajberg; Simon Larsson; Lars-Olof Nordin; Luleå tekniska universitet; []
    Nyckelord :TEKNIK OCH TEKNOLOGIER; ENGINEERING AND TECHNOLOGY; Hållfasthetslära; Solid Mechanics;

    Sammanfattning : Comminution is one of the highest energy-consuming processes in the mining and mineral processing industry by consuming around 2% of the global generated energy with an overall efficiency of 1-3%.   5. 30. Heterogeneous Bonded Particle Modelling of Rock Fracture

    Författare :Albin Wessling; Jörgen Kajberg; Simon Larsson; Pär Jonsén; Timo Saksala; Luleå tekniska universitet; []
    Nyckelord :TEKNIK OCH TEKNOLOGIER; ENGINEERING AND TECHNOLOGY; Rock; DEM; BPM; fracture; drilling; dynamic; Solid Mechanics; Hållfasthetslära;

    Sammanfattning : The dynamic fracture process of rock materials is of importance for several industries, such as the rock drilling process in geothermal and mining applications. Gaining knowledge and understanding of dynamic rock fracture through numerical simulations can enhance the rock drilling process, for example by optimising the drill bit geometry and drilling parameters.
